> You need to watch out for "family stories."  Sometimes, that is what they 
> are - just stories. Usually told to amuse the kids (especially before radio 
> and television). These kids grew up and became our parents or grandparents 
> and retold the stories that they heard as children. And childhood memories 
> can be funny things. No one wants to call grandma a liar, but if she is 
> telling a story that she heard as a child, it may be just a story that was 
> told to amuse her. Little kids are gullible and believe most things they 
> are told.
>
> Manuel's baptism had margin notes. Only 1 marriage was noted. I think it 
> said he married in the 1920s. Those records are not online. I've seen 
> margin notes where they noted the marriage, noted that the marriage was 
> dissolved by death of the spouse and they married a 2nd time. Could someone 
> have forgot to note a marriage? Well, they are human and humans make 
> mistakes. But probably not. The only way to be sure would be to order 
> Manuel's marriage from the 1920s and see if it says he was the widower of 
> ________ and is marrying Maria Cabral.
